Delhi Duty Free at IGI Airport launches Dewar’s Legacy Collection 1893


Delhi Duty Free (DDF) at Terminal 3 of Indira Gandhi International (IGI) Airport launched Dewar’s Legacy Collection 1893, a limited edition of blended Scotch whisky.


DDF, in association with Bacardi Global Travel Retail, was the first duty-free in India to sell the limited-edition, priced at $3,888, to international travellers travelling from the Indian capital.

The Scotch whisky is presented in a crystal decanter jewelled with sapphires and hand-crafted silverware with a design influenced by a Scottish ceremonial dagger, while the decanter is housed in a burr walnut and gold metal box.

Gaurav Joshi, head, Travel Retail Business India and the South Asian Association Regional Cooperation (SAARC)-Bacardi Global Travel Retail Division, said, “The legacy collection whisky is a blend of more than 20 rare and long-aged whiskies, many of which were used by Dewar’s founder John Dewar in the earlier editions.”

He said, “This is the first launch of the three Dewar’s legacy collections, and only 50 pieces out of a thousand worldwide will be available.”

Joshi informed that the legacy collection would be available in Delhi till March next year, after which the collection may be launched in other places in the country.
